    How to use:


    -Combine the powder contents of this bag with 4 tbl spoons of water. Mix thoroughly, removing any
    lumps and apply immediately as a thick, even layer. Leave on your skin until the mask has set as a
    firm jelly, and then simply peel off. Moisturize skin after.

     

    When to use:
    -Can be used once or twice weekly
